About Stephen Navaretta at a glance
Stephen Navaretta is a Member based in Port St. Lucie, Florida, practicing at Navaretta & Navaretta, P.A.. They have 52+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1974. Their practice focuses on business. Admitted to practice in Florida (1974), Washington (1977), and New York (2003). Educated at University of Miami School of Law (J.D. University, 1974). Recognitions include BV Distinguished. Serands clients in Port St. Lucie, FL and the surrounding metropolitan area.

Jurisdictional Context
Why local counsel matters in Florida
Practicing law in Florida. Legal matters in Florida are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Port St. Lucie are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Florida state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Florida br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Florida cour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
